1998 International Workshop
SPEECH AND COMPUTER (SPECOM'98)
26-29 October 1998, St-Petersburg, Russia
Organized by St-Petersburg Institute for Informatics and
Automation of the Russian Academy of Sciences (SPIIRAS)
in cooperation with State Pedagogical University of Russia
Supported by the European Speech Communication Association (ESCA)
and European Network in Language and Speech (ELSNET)
FIRST CALL FOR PAPERS
GENERAL CHAIR:
Rafael M.Yusupov
SPIIRAS,St-Petersburg, Russia
The International workshop 'Speech and Computer' - SPECOM'98
will cover the most important topics of speech-computer
interaction. It is aimed to obtaining and using new original
adequate approaches to spoken language understanding by
means of integration results of pattern recognition, quantitative
linguistics, information theory, psychoacoustics, and other related
areas.
SPECOM'98 will be held with especial emphasis on spoken language
understanding concepts and approaches.
TOPICS to be covered include, but are not limited to:
- Conceptual models for natural spoken language;
- Models for spoken language semantic interpretation;
- Integration of diverse knowledge in the speech understanding process;
- Using prosodical knowledge in speech semantic interpretation;
- Speech-to-speech translation;
- Telephone natural language response generation;
- Speech dialogue models creation;
- Spontaneous speech perception modeling;
- Multi-lingual and multi-modal systems;
- Psychological approaches to speech understanding;
- Applied systems.
